Output 5066ca95b515b8ea300cca99dc146d4fc435ce3a37f997d0f330a5a8fa7e29a5:2

value
9850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2e7c2bddf0e0be88d420be692d2c8f8f08c343c OP_EQUAL
address
3PqP5yyWEWGxMMdPQcnTx61fLwF1HqGUCX
transaction
5066ca95b515b8ea300cca99dc146d4fc435ce3a37f997d0f330a5a8fa7e29a5
spent
true